eMachines T5246

eMachines T5246
Full Set Tower Angle Mouse

REVIEW

The eMachines T5246 ($430 direct), this budget-PC maker's "top-of-the-line" model, is a welcome break from the company's past desktops: It's the first Vista budget PC from eMachines with 2GB of system memory. It's the sort of desktop system you'd find in a big-box store, take home and unpack, and quickly set up and use. When picturing its target audience, phrases such as "third home PC," "great for the kids," or "we need another computer, but not one that's too expensive" come to mind.

Spec Data
  • Price as Tested: $430.00
  • Type: General Purpose, Value
  • Processor Family: AMD Athlon 64 X2
  • RAM: 2 GB
  • Storage Capacity: 400 GB
  • RAID: No
  • Graphics Card: nVidia GeForce 6100
  • Primary Optical Drive: Dual-Layer DVD+/-RW

Bottom Line

The eMachines T5246 is another decent budget choice made better, but some of the components are starting to look dated.

Pros

Under $500 for the "top-of-the-line" eMachine system. 2GB of system memory. 400GB hard drive.

Cons

Still a lot of bloatware. Dated integrated graphics. Free Norton Internet Security subscription drops to 60 days. A ball mouse—in 2008?
